Error nohup in cron

Hello Gurus,

I have written two simple shell scripts which i want to run daily via cronjob.
One of the scripts contains "nohup" ,which is not getting executed when i run via cron.

Why does "nohup" is not working via cron?

Both the scripts work well when i run them manually.I have tested them.

Is there any "Setting enviroment" for cron to be set ?

# 7  
Old 11-20-2005
Or do:

program_name > logfile 2>&1

That gives you everything. You don't need the nohup; that's only if you're running a long job on a terminal.

For the other question, we'd need to see output.

For the last two questions: It is my experience that most cron problems are caused by the script writer forgetting that cron's environment is quite small and tight. PATH is minimal, dot files are not read, etc. You should make a habit of setting PATH and any other environment variables explicitly in any scripts you write that are for use by cron.
